Kolls and Johnston lead Knights golfers at Anderson

ANDERSON, S.C.—Senior John Kolls (Durham, N.C.) finished tied for sixth with an even-par 144 total to lead the St .Andrews Presbyterian College men’s golf team at the Anderson University Invitational at the Brookstone Meadows Golf Club on Monday and Tuesday. Senior Andrea Johnston (Chapel Hill, N.C.) led three Lady Knights’ individuals with a 172 total.

The SAPC men’s golf team finished eighth out of nine teams with a 705 total. Tusculum College won the team title by two strokes over the host Trojans with a 578 total.

Kolls opened up his final year at St. Andrews with a two-under par 70 on the 6,685-yard, par-72 Brookstone Meadows layout. Kolls followed Monday’s impressive round with a 74 to finish tied for sixth out of 46 golfers.

Sophomore Alfred Kristinsson (Reykjavik, Iceland) followed Kolls with a T-14th place finish with a three-over 74-73-147 scorecard. Freshmen Scott Bennett (Laurinburg, N.C.) and Matt Doyle (LaQuinta, Calif.) opened up their collegiate careers with 84-75-159 and 78-83-161 rounds, respectively.

Rounding out the St. Andrews men’s team was senior Rebel Kennedy (Sundridge, Ontario, Canada) with a 84-95-179 total.

The Lady Knights opened up the 2006-2007 season with only three individuals competing in the opening tournament. USC-Upstate won the women’s team title by 32 strokes over Tusculum with a 620 total.

Johnston opened up her senior campaign with rounds of 88 and 84 on the 6,116-yard, par-72 layout. The 172 total was goof for a tie for 27th place out of 49 golfers.

Junior Laura Correia (Centerville, Mass.) opened up her playing career at St. Andrews posting a total of 93-90-183. Sophomore Alessandra Maurtua (Lima, Peru) carded a 93-92-185 total.

The Knights head to Badin Lake, N.C., for the Johnny Palmer/Old North State Invitational (hosted by Pfeiffer) on Monday and Tuesday, September 18-19. The Lady Knights return to competition in two weeks when they host the St. Andrews Fall Invitational at the Deercroft Golf and Country Club in Wagram, N.C. on Monday and Tuesday, September 25-26.
